Understanding Arbitrum and the ARB Token

Arbitrum is an Ethereum Layer 2 scaling solution built using Optimistic Rollup technology. It processes transactions off the main Ethereum chain (off-chain execution) and then submits compressed data back to Ethereum for final settlement. This approach dramatically reduces gas fees and congestion on the Ethereum network while preserving decentralization and security.

The ARB token plays a central role in the governance of the Arbitrum ecosystem. Token holders can participate in decision-making processes such as protocol upgrades, parameter adjustments, and treasury management. However, unlike some other Layer 2 networks, ARB is not used to pay transaction fees — those are still paid in ETH.

Key Features of Arbitrum’s Technology

Optimistic Rollups Explained

At the core of Arbitrum’s architecture is Optimistic Rollup, a technique that assumes transactions are valid by default. Only if a dispute arises is fraud-proof verification triggered on-chain. This minimizes computational load on Ethereum while ensuring security through cryptographic guarantees.

Growing Ecosystem

Arbitrum hosts major DeFi platforms like Uniswap, Aave, GMX, and Curve, making it a hub for yield farming, trading, and lending. Its developer-friendly environment encourages innovation and rapid deployment of new projects.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is Arbitrum used for?

Arbitrum is designed to scale Ethereum by processing transactions off-chain using Optimistic Rollups. It enables cheaper, faster interactions with dApps while relying on Ethereum for security and finality.

Can I use Arbitrum without buying ARB?

Yes. You only need ETH for gas fees on Arbitrum. ARB is optional unless you want to participate in governance or stake in future programs.

How does Arbitrum differ from other Layer 2 solutions?

Unlike ZK-Rollups (e.g., zkSync, StarkNet), Arbitrum uses Optimistic Rollups with a dispute resolution mechanism. It offers full EVM compatibility and faster time-to-market for developers, though withdrawal periods to Ethereum can take up to 7 days.

Where can I check Arbitrum’s blockchain activity?

Explore live data through block explorers like Arbiscan. You can track transactions, smart contracts, token flows, and network health metrics.

Does Arbitrum have lower fees than Ethereum?

Significantly. Because most computation happens off-chain, users typically pay a fraction of Ethereum’s gas costs — especially during peak network usage.
